The game says it has 10 different games, but really there are only about 5 different games & the other 5 are either 2 player options of that game or somehow a slight variation on 1 of the games, though I couldn't find the difference in them. Some of the games are very easy & some are quite hard which makes this a game that anyone can enjoy, from little kids all the way up to adults. I did notice that sometimes when pushing the back that's supposed to pop all the buttons back out, didn't work & some of the buttons would stay in or none of them would pop back out at all. Also, the screws that hold the battery compartment's back on were missing when I got the game. This wasn't a huge deal b/c I hate those screws, especially when the back stays on properly without them. Not having them allows you to change the batteries more easily. This is simple but well worth the $12. It can help kids with hand/eye coordination, if they're old enough to understand the rules. Even without the game portion this thing is a great fidget toy for any age. The game: You press the power button and begin at level 1. The pop-ups will have some with lights turned on. You press down the ones that are lit and then press the backside to quickly push all the bubbles up and begin level 2. I only used the standard game which is pretty simple for kids to understand - only push down the bubbles that have the light on. I messed around with it just to see why my niece said it is too hard. You have a time limit in which you must press down all the lighted bubbles and if you make a mistake you'll start over at level 1. The game is fairly lenient with the amount of time but it does decrease as you increase levels. I made it to level 12 in less than 5 minutes and the levels didn't get too complicated, but you will see that more bubbles light up and they will be more spread out across the pad. I imagine it gets much more difficult at higher levels. Got this for my nearly 5 year old niece. She likes it and was able to engage with the actual game, but quickly got frustrated due to the limited amount of time you are allowed to push all the buttons that are lighted. I'm looking forward to helping her learn perseverance and persistence while she tries to go further than level 5. This has been great for coordination, but also can help kids develop healthy ways to deal with frustration (if you take the time to teach them). ... show more
